Richard A. Grasso, the ex-New York Stock Exchange chairman, will ask the New York Appellate Division, 1st Department, to review Justice Charles E. Ramos’ decision ordering him to repay as much as $100 million in compensation from his former employer.

“Justice Ramos recently wrote that he takes comfort from the fact that the Appellate Division will review his rulings,” Grasso said late Thursday. “So do I.”
